I am interested in buying a small sail boat (less than 30 ft). Curious, is a license necessary to pilot such a boat? Many thanks for any advice.

Yes you do need a license. Marine Dept requires 2 licenses if your boat has an engine (most sail boats that are above dinghy size have an engine) There are Grade 1 and Grade 2 licenses depending on size of boat and engine
*Masters license - this covers the 'rules of the water' for want of better terminology. Navigation, markers, rules, regulations, safety etc particularly for HK but also worldwide.
*Engineers license - this is the engine maintenance and safety side of things - test covers three engine type - small inboard, large inboard and outboard. You have to pass each section to get a license for each engine. eg - you may pass inboard but not outboard or vice versa.
the test is not that difficult if you study, and a lot of the boating places and yacht clubs run courses that help you pass. The course usually cost around a few thousand dollars and are worth doing because these guys know the sort of questions that are asked and they also let you do sample exams.

One more thing.....any insurance would be invalid if you were found to be unlicensed!

You do not need a licence to sail a "small" boat in HK...
You should buy a Hobie 16, or a Hobie Tiger (18 foot). They are great fun. The 16s are not too expensive and you can just take one out with a mate and practise on it!
www.hobie.com.hk (their club is located on this cute beach in Tai Tam).
DB also have lots of sailboats going out from there - you can see the club at the beach there.
Or you can take a government course, or a dinghy sailing course from any yacht club in HK.
